On back: "AMAZON IN ALLEGORY FOR WESTERN WORLD'S FAIR - The above piece of sculpture - an amazon boy capturing an alligator, representing Brazilian Indian life - will grace the majestic Fountain of Western Waters in the Court of Pacifica at the 1939 World's Fair of the West on San Francisco Bay. Cecilia Bancroft Graham, San Francisco sculptress, is shown touching up a huge clay model. (GOLDEN GATE INTERNATIONAL EXPOSITION) 8-191-EG".
